Hi Tracey, everyone seems to have a different experience but for me, my hair came back in almost black (I'd been a practising blonde for many years!) so it was definitely a big change! It also was wavy and very fine, a huge change from having thick, straight hair. For the first 6 months or so I used baby shampoo as it was gentle on the hair and scalp.
I'm now 2 years on from the end of active treatment and my hair is long again but still much finer than my original hair and it has lightened - with a bit of help from my hairdresser! It has also lost its curl. It grows much slower than previously which saves a bit on haircuts :-) I do however really miss my once thick eyebrows and lashes. Both are still quite sparse, so have become pretty good with the eyebrow pencil (thanks to the Look good feel better workshop) and use an eyeliner as well as my trusty Great Lash mascara to make the most of what's there.
